#DB8AA5 Color
#DB8AA5 is rgb(219, 138, 165) in RGB, hsl(340, 53%, 70%) in HSL, and about cmyk(0%, 37%, 25%, 14%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Charm Pink (#E68FAC), very hard to tell apart at ΔE 3.43.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#DB8AA5 Channel Values
How #DB8AA5 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 219 · G 138 · B 165 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 340° · S 53% · L 70%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 340° · S 37% · V 86%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 0% · M 37% · Y 25% · K 14%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 2.56:1 vs white · 8.19: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#DB8AA5 background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#DB8AA5 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#DB8AA5?
#DB8AA5 is a light pink — rgb(219, 138, 165) in RGB and hsl(340, 53%, 70%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Charm Pink (#E68FAC), which is very hard to tell apart at a CIE76 distance of 3.43.
What is the RGB value of #DB8AA5?
#DB8AA5 is rgb(219, 138, 165) — red 219, green 138, and blue 165 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#DB8AA5?
#DB8AA5 converts to approximately cmyk(0%, 37%, 25%, 14%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#DB8AA5 be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#DB8AA5 scores 2.56:1 against white and 8.19: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#DB8AA5 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#DB8AA5 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is palevioletred (#DB7093) at a CIE76 distance of 12.66, which is visibly different.
